Steer clear of the top 10 marketing & communications mistake
Effective marketing and communication play a crucial role in the success of any business strategy. Unfortunately, even seasoned professionals can fall prey to common mistakes that can have a detrimental effect on their efforts. To help you avoid these pitfalls, this article will delve into the top 10 marketing and communications mistakes that can hinder business growth. Using data figures, we will showcase the negative consequences of these mistakes and provide insights on how to steer clear of them.
1. Not Knowing Your Target Audience
The biggest mistake businesses make is not understanding their target audience. According to a survey by HubSpot, 61% of marketers believe that understanding their audience is crucial for the success of their campaigns (HubSpot, 2021). Without a clear understanding of your target audience, it is impossible to create effective marketing campaigns.
2. Not Having a Clear Message
To achieve effective marketing and communication, it is imperative to have a clear and concise message. An unclear message can leave your audience confused about what you are offering and how it can benefit them. A recent survey conducted by Salesforce found that 52% of consumers consider a clear message to be the most crucial factor in creating a positive experience with a brand. This highlights the importance of ensuring your message is easy to understand and resonates with your target audience.
3. Ignoring Social Media
Social media is a potent tool for connecting with your audience, yet a significant number of businesses are still ignoring its potential. Shockingly, a recent survey conducted by Pew Research Center found that a staggering 69% of adults in the United States use social media (Pew Research Center). By overlooking social media, businesses are squandering an enormous potential audience. It is crucial for businesses to leverage social media to reach their target audience and foster engagement with their brand.
4. Focusing on Quantity Over Quality
Producing a large volume of content is not always the key to success, and yet many businesses continue to hold this belief. The truth is that it is far more effective to create high-quality content that resonates with your target audience. In fact, a recent survey conducted by Content Marketing Institute found that a significant majority of marketers (60%) prioritize the quality of their content over quantity. This emphasizes the importance of producing content that offers real value and relevance to your audience, rather than simply churning out an endless stream of low-quality material.
5. Not Measuring Your Results
It is imperative to measure the results of your marketing and communication efforts to gauge their effectiveness. Failing to do so would leave you in the dark about what's working and what isn't. A study conducted by Google revealed that 61% of marketers use analytics tools to track their results. This highlights the significance of utilizing data analytics to gain insight into the performance of your marketing and communication strategies. By doing so, you can refine and optimize your efforts for better results.

6. Overlooking Email Marketing
Email marketing is an extremely potent tool for engaging with your audience. As per a survey by DMA, email marketing generates an average ROI of $42 for every dollar spent. However, many businesses fail to recognize the potential of email marketing and overlook it, resulting in missed opportunities for a substantial return on investment. It is essential for businesses to leverage email marketing as a powerful means of connecting with their target audience and driving measurable business growth.
7. Not Providing Value
To build a meaningful connection with your audience, your marketing and communication efforts must provide real value. If your messaging is overly self-promotional and fails to deliver any tangible value to your audience, they are unlikely to engage with it. In fact, a recent survey conducted by Content Marketing Institute found that a significant majority of consumers (68%) prioritize content that provides value over other factors when it comes to creating a positive experience with a brand. This highlights the importance of creating content that speaks directly to the needs and interests of your target audience, rather than simply promoting your products or services. By doing so, you can establish a genuine connection with your audience, foster brand loyalty, and drive business growth.
8. Neglecting Your Website
Your website is a crucial point of contact between your business and your audience. Ignoring its importance can have detrimental effects on your marketing and communication efforts. A survey conducted by Stanford highlights that 75% of consumers assess a business's credibility based on its website's design. Therefore, it is essential to prioritize website design and ensure that it is visually appealing, user-friendly, and optimized for performance. This can help to establish a positive impression among your target audience, enhance your brand's credibility, and drive business growth.
9. Failing to Adapt
Businesses need to stay on top of emerging trends in marketing and communication to remain relevant and effective. For instance, while Facebook used to be the dominant social media platform, younger demographics have shifted to Instagram and TikTok. By ignoring these platforms, businesses risk missing out on reaching these audiences and losing market share to competitors. Additionally, video consumption has skyrocketed, with 81% of businesses using video as a marketing tool in 2021. Failing to incorporate video marketing into your strategy could mean missing opportunities to engage with audiences who prefer video content. Personalization is also a critical trend, as delivering personalized content can lead to higher engagement and conversion rates. Neglecting personalization could result in less impactful campaigns and lower engagement. In summary, keeping up with emerging trends and adapting marketing and communication strategies accordingly is essential for long-term success.
10. Not Engaging with Your Audience
Building a relationship with your audience is vital to ensure brand loyalty and success. Ignoring your audience can cause you to miss out on potential customers, as 83% of consumers believe that it's crucial for brands to engage with them, according to Sprout Social. Responding to comments, messages, and reviews quickly and genuinely is a great way to develop a positive brand image and establish trust with your audience. For instance, a company that responds to customer complaints and feedback through social media or email and provides them with a satisfactory solution in a timely manner can earn a positive reputation for being customer-centric.
